Ivy Sandra Jost

January 7, 1938 ~ June 27, 2026 (age 88) 88 Years Old

Ivy Sandra Siegfried Jost, the loving daughter of Charles and Gladys Siegfried, passed away on the morning of June 27th, 2026, after overcoming a four-year battle with cancer.

She is survived by her high school sweetheart and beloved husband of 68 years, Donald E Jost, and their three children, Donna Tolson (Timothy Tolson) of Crozet, VA, Steven Jost (Joyce Jost) of West Grove, PA, and Thomas Jost (Patricia Boustany) of Staten Island, NY, as well as six grandchildren (Ben Tolson, Zachary Tolson, Kayla Thompson, Donovan Jost, Griffin Boustany and Noura Costany) and six great grandchildren. She was predeceased by her sister, Virginia (Gini) and brother, Bruce, and leaves behind beloved nieces, a nephew, cousins, and many, many friends. Her family and friends brought her unending joy. 

Ivy graduated from Upper Darby High School and attended the University of Delaware, Delaware County Community College, and Neumann University, where she received her bachelor’s degree.

She was a devoted wife and mother who loved children. She was often the “home room mother” for her children’s classes and den mother for Cub Scouts. When her children were older, she became a preschool teacher and daycare administrator. She volunteered for many organizations, churches, and schools in the communities in which she lived, most recently for the Kennett Library Adult Literacy Program. She was an active member of Reformation Lutheran Church in Media, PA, and Westminster Presbyterian Church in West Chester, PA, where she was a deacon. She had a great love of music and sang in choruses and choirs throughout her life. Ivy, along with her husband, enjoyed traveling both in the USA and abroad and often with friends. For many years they sailed on the Chesapeake in their boat, the Gypsy. Ivy loved the beach and for much of her life found time every year to go to the Jersey shore with family and friends, building lifelong memories. Her hobbies included singing, gardening, reading, cooking, bridge, poetry writing and bird watching.  She loved hosting friends and family, and their home was always a welcoming place for relatives, friends and neighbors whom she adored.

A Celebration of Life service will be held on Friday, July 10, at the Westminster Presbyterian Church, 10 West Pleasant Grove Road, West Chester, PA; visitation at 10 am and service at 11 am.  A luncheon will follow the service at the church. 

In lieu of flowers, Ivy has requested that donations be sent to the Kennett Library Adult Literacy Program or the Abramson Cancer Center.
